Guildford is a historic market town in the south east of England, within easy reach of London. Our Guildford campus is set within 23 acres of beautiful parkland.
About Guildford
Guildford is one of the most popular places in the South of England for pubs, restaurants, bars and clubbing. There are two excellent theatres and an Odeon cinema, as well as a large leisure centre and state of the art sports complex, Surrey Sports Park. Guildford is a bustling, student-friendly town with a diverse range of eateries that cater to all tastes. All this is surrounded by Surrey's area of outstanding natural beauty.
Our law school is easily accessible by public transport or car, and just a 20 minute walk to Guildford’s train station and the town centre. What sets this campus apart is its history, the green spaces and walking trails that surround it.

Braboeuf Manor – home to our Guildford Campus
Our Guildford campus is based at the historical site of Braboeuf Manor which takes its name from the Brébeuf Norman family who came to England with William the Conqueror in 1066. Hugue(s) de Brébeuf is mentioned in the which lists the men who fought with William the Conqueror. The Brébeufs owned the Guildford estate from 1231 to 1362. Other notable members of the family include Jean de Brébeuf, a well-known missionary who travelled to Canada in 1625 where he studied the native languages of indigenous people of Northern America.
